A mixture of compound 20-1 (2 g, . 0535 mol), Boc piperazine 20-2 (3.32 g, . 017F mol, Aldrich), K2CO3 (7.39 g, . 0535 mol) and copper (. 0756 g, . 00119 mmol) in DMF (25 ML) was refluxed at 185 C overnight. The solution was cooled to room temperature, poured into 50 ML of ice water (50 ML) and extracted with EtOAc (3 x 50 mL). The combined organic layers were dried and concentrated in vacuo to give compound 20-3.
